when i preform a FFT2 (of an image) it is simple to compress it by ignoring the edges and then to reconstruct using ifft.
but how can i do the same using wavelet transform?
when i preform a wavelet transform of a 2D image i get 4 different matrices (approximation, vertical, horizontal and diagonal details).
and by using:
[C,S]=wavedec2(I,level,wname);
simply provides me with a long vector C of the matrices above.
i found this:
[I_c]=wdencmp('lvd',C,S,wname,level,thr,sorh);
it suppose to compress the wavelet transform up to a cetrain threshold 'thr', but i can't figure out how to set the 'thr' parameter according to the ammount of coefficients that ware compressed.
is there any other way?
